Income Taxes

The liability method is used in the Company’s accounting for income taxes. Under this method, deferred tax assets and liabilities are determined based on differences between financial reporting and tax bases of assets and liabilities and are measured using the enacted tax rates and laws that are expected to be in effect when the differences are expected to reverse.

As part of the Tax Cuts and Jobs Act of 2017 (TCJA), beginning with the 2022 tax year, the Company is required to capitalize research and development expenses, as defined under Internal Revenue Code section 174. For expenses that are incurred for research and development in the U.S., the amounts will be amortized over five years, and expenses that are incurred for research and experimentation outside the U.S. will be amortized over 15 years. 

As of March 31, 2023, the Company determined a provision for income tax was not required for the calendar year ended December 31, 2023.
